I studied Radio Frequency engineering in the sunny city of Krasnodar, located northwestward from the crest line of the Caucasus Mountains on the plains east of the Black Sea. After moving to the United States in 2016, I worked in the area of particle accelerators at Fermilab in Chicago. I switched to quantum information science in 2018, focusing on radio frequency instrumentation. Since 2022, I've been working at IBM Research in Yorktown Heights, New York, on the control and readout electronics for superconducting qubits.
My favorite research areas are instrument design, radio frequency measurements, and calibration.
